7. Formulários e inputs em HTML

Página 42

7. Formulários e inputs em HTML

Formulários são uma parte essencial da interação do usuário com uma página da web. Eles permitem que os usuários insiram dados que podem ser enviados para um servidor para processamento. Os formulários podem ser usados para coisas como pesquisa, login, inscrição e muito mais. Neste capítulo, vamos discutir como criar formulários e usar diferentes tipos de input em HTML.

Formulários em HTML

Os formulários em HTML são criados usando a tag <form>. A tag <form> atua como um contêiner para diferentes elementos de formulário, como campos de entrada, botões e muito mais.

<form action="/submit" method="post">
  <!-- elementos do formulário aqui -->
</form>

O atributo 'action' na tag <form> especifica para onde os dados do formulário devem ser enviados quando o formulário é enviado. O atributo 'method' especifica como os dados do formulário devem ser enviados. Os métodos mais comuns são 'get' e 'post'.

Inputs em HTML

Os campos de entrada são usados para coletar dados do usuário. Eles são criados usando a tag <input>. Existem muitos tipos diferentes de campos de entrada que podem ser usados, dependendo do tipo de dados que você deseja coletar.

Texto

Para coletar um único linha de texto, você pode usar o tipo de entrada 'text'.

<input type="text" name="firstname" id="firstname">

O atributo 'name' é usado para identificar o campo de entrada quando os dados são enviados. O atributo 'id' é usado para identificar o campo de entrada no CSS e JavaScript.

Senha

Para coletar uma senha, você pode usar o tipo de entrada 'password'. Isso oculta os caracteres à medida que são digitados.

<input type="password" name="password" id="password">

Email

Para coletar um endereço de e-mail, você pode usar o tipo de entrada 'email'. Isso valida automaticamente o campo para garantir que um endereço de e-mail válido seja inserido.

<input type="email" name="email" id="email">

Botões

Os botões são usados para enviar o formulário. Eles são criados usando a tag <button> ou a tag <input> com o tipo definido como 'submit'.

<button type="submit">Enviar</button>
<input type="submit" value="Enviar">

Outros tipos de entrada

Existem muitos outros tipos de entrada que você pode usar, incluindo 'radio', 'checkbox', 'file', 'date', 'color' e muito mais. Cada tipo tem suas próprias características e usos específicos.

Conclusão

Os formulários e campos de entrada são uma parte essencial da construção de sites interativos. Eles permitem que você colete dados do usuário e os envie para um servidor para processamento. Ao entender como usar diferentes tipos de campos de entrada, você pode criar formulários mais eficientes e eficazes que atendam às necessidades de seus usuários.

Pratique a criação de diferentes tipos de formulários e usando diferentes tipos de entrada. Experimente diferentes atributos e veja como eles afetam o comportamento do seu formulário. Lembre-se de que a melhor maneira de aprender é fazendo!

Ahora responde el ejercicio sobre el contenido:

Qual é a função da tag <form> em HTML e quais atributos são comumente usados com ela?

¡Tienes razón! Felicitaciones, ahora pasa a la página siguiente.

¡Tú error! Inténtalo de nuevo.

Siguiente página del libro electrónico gratuito:

438. Introdução ao CSS: seletores, propriedades e valores

¡Obtén tu certificado para este curso gratis! descargando la aplicación Cursa y leyendo el libro electrónico allí. ¡Disponible en Google Play o App Store!

Disponible en Google Play Disponible en App Store

+ 6,5 millones
estudiantes

Certificado gratuito y
válido con código QR

48 mil ejercicios
gratis

Calificación de 4.8/5
en tiendas de aplicaciones

Cursos gratuitos de
vídeo, audio y texto.